If the Premier League’s board has reasonable grounds to “suspect” that it is an associated party deal or “otherwise than at arm’s length” then an independent firm will determine whether it is of fair market value or has been artificially inflated.</p> <p>The advent of the Newcastle pumping money into the Club raised concerns that it will be able to artificially raised sponsorship deals to raise its finances and therefore be able to get round Financial Fair Play Rules.&nbsp;</p> <h3><strong>What are Financial Fair Play Rules?</strong></h3> <p>Initially&nbsp;<a class="story-body__external-link" href="http://www.uefa.com/community/news/newsid=2064391.html">introduced by Uefa&nbsp;</a>&nbsp;to prevent clubs spending beyond their means.&nbsp; It was to ensure fair play between clubs and also to stop or at least reduce the risk of football clubs going bust.&nbsp; The first thing the Club must ensure, in reality is to prevent the&nbsp; heart ruling the head.&nbsp; That is prevent overspend particularly on players and the wage bill, the most expensive part of running a football club.</p> <p>According to UEFA Clubs can spend up to 5m euros (£3.9m) more than they earn per assessment period made over a rolling three-year period.&nbsp;&nbsp;<a href="https://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/football/29361839">BBC Sport</a>,&nbsp; reports that Clubs need to balance football-related expenditure - transfers and wages - with television and ticket income, plus revenues raised by their commercial departments. Money spent on stadiums, training facilities, youth development or community projects is exempt.&nbsp;</p> <p><strong>Fines</strong></p> <p>The potential punishments includs warnings, fines, withholding prize money, transfer bans, points deductions, a ban on registration of new players and a restriction on the number of players who can be registered for Uefa competitions.</p> <p>Nine clubs were found to have breached the FFP criteria in the first assessment period, most notably <a class="story-body__internal-link" href="http://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/0/football/27445475">Manchester City</a> and Paris St-Germain, and a range of fines and sanctions were imposed.</p> <p>City were fined £49m, £32m of which was suspended, had spending restrictions imposed and could only name a 21-man Champions League squad for 2014-15.</p> <h3>Getting Real on FFP</h3> <p>The Premier League is the most caters for the most valuable sport on earth.&nbsp; It must be seen to do the right thing, apply the rules and ensure fair play between all clubs.&nbsp; But it must also be applied equally across all Countries so the likes of PSG, Real Madrid and Barcelona et al are also covered.</p> <p>Let us know what you think.</p> <p><strong><br /></strong></p> </div> </div> </div> <div class="field field-type-filefield field-field-blog-image"> <div class="field-items"> <div class="field-item odd"> <img class="imagefield imagefield-field_blog_image" width="600" height="600" alt="" src="http://footballagents.org.uk/sites/default/files/images/blog/football-agent-2801.jpg?1640170885" /> </div> </div> </div> http://footballagents.org.uk/blog/premier-league-vet-sponsorships#comments football Leauge Premier Sponsorship News Wed, 22 Dec 2021 11:00:21 +0000 faagent 61335 at http://footballagents.org.uk LIVERPOOL, RECORD BREAKERS http://footballagents.org.uk/blog/liverpool-record-breakers <div class="field field-type-text field-field-blog-content"> <div class="field-items"> <div class="field-item odd"> <p>LIVERPOOL, RECORD BREAKERS</p><p>Not a good start, or a good game to be fair. Managers are increasingly making use of real-time data for matches, with companies such as <a href="https://statsports.com/">STATSports</a> producing technology that provides 32 in-game metrics</p> <p>Three Quarters of Premier League Clubs Use Technology on Player Performance</p> <p>A pod attached to the back of the vests collects analytics using software that monitors the movements of a player up to 1,000 times a second. Pitchside beacons, held on tripods, bounce a signal from GPS satellites to the pods, and the data is then transmitted to the smartwatches and tablets in real time.</p> <p>Reported in the Times Newspaper it says:</p> <p>“Now, this allows you to affect things live so you’re not trying to manage after the events,” Sean O’Connor, the co-founder of STATSports, based in Newry, says.</p> <p>“People are able to take that data during games and make decisions,” he said. “What that allows you to do is build a profile on a player. You expect a player to do X, Y, Z in training and games. When they start to move away from those norms it can be for good or bad reasons.</p> <p>“If they are in a training session and there is 25 minutes left and they have gone way past what you normally expect them to do, then you can make a call to either taper it off or take them in early.</p> <p>“It’s the same concept in a game as well. If the manager is deciding between two players to replace, he could ask his coach what feedback can you give, physically.”</p> <h3 class="responsivewebparagraph-sc-1isfdlb-0"><strong>Players wear GPS vests</strong></h3> <p><strong>&nbsp;</strong><br /> Players wear GPS trackers which monitor 32 different categories including speed, distance run, heart rate and acceleration. The tracker sits in a vest which can be worn underneath players’ shirts on matchday. Data collected is beamed to a satellite.</p> <p>&nbsp;</p> <p><strong>Boosters allow real-time tracking</strong></p> <p><strong>&nbsp;</strong>Portable beacons stationed on tripods around the pitch bounce a GPS signal to the trackers which allows them to collect data in real time.</p> <p><strong>Results beamed to coaches’ watches</strong></p> <p><strong>&nbsp;</strong>Coaches can access live performance statistics on their laptops, tablets or smart watches via an app. They will be able to know more accurately if a particular player needs to be rested.</p> </div> </div> </div> http://footballagents.org.uk/blog/football-technology-helps-coaches-prevent-injury-players#comments fitness football Injury Liverpoolfc Premier League sports science General Fri, 21 Aug 2020 10:06:46 +0000 faagent 47618 at http://footballagents.org.uk Breaking Klopp to Leave Liverpool http://footballagents.org.uk/blog/breaking-klopp-leave-liverpool <div class="field field-type-text field-field-blog-content"> <div class="field-items"> <div class="field-item odd"> <p>The unthinkable it to happen for Liverpool Fans, Jurgen Klopp has spoken about his departing from the Club.&nbsp; To Liverpool Fans he is the God of football and is worshipped in those Northern parts that has brought success.</p> <p>The good news is that is it four years away, the bad news is that he is thinking about leaving, not just the club for Football in general.</p> <p>Jürgen Klopp has said he plans to take a year off when his Liverpool contract expires in 2024 and will only return to management should he miss the challenge.</p> <p>&nbsp;</p> <h4 class="responsiveweb__Paragraph-sc-1isfdlb-0 YieBL"><strong>What Klopp Actually Said</strong></h4> <p>“I’ll take a year off and ask myself if I miss football,” he said in an interview with Sportbuzzer. “If I say no, then that will be the end&nbsp;of coach Jürgen Klopp.</p> <p> </p> <p>“If one day I am no longer a coach, there is one thing I will not miss: the brutal tension immediately before the game.”</p> <p>five-year deal last December</a>&nbsp;to extend his previous contract, which had been due to expire in 2022, and in doing so drew a line through the prospect of taking a sabbatical then.</p> <p>However, Klopp has said he will finally be ready for a break after nine years at Anfield and could walk away from football completely at the age of 57.</p> <p>In The Times is is reported:</p> <p>Klopp has never spent more than seven years at a club since stepping into management at FSV Mainz 05, and continuing his career at Borussia Dortmund, and the prospect of outstripping those stays speaks volumes for the depth of feeling he has for Liverpool.</p> <p>Winning the Champions League in 2019 was followed by the club’s first league title for 30 years, with the silverware establishing Klopp as one of the greatest managers in the club’s history.</p> <p>Liverpool are currently in Austria on a pre-season camp where Klopp is plotting further success.</p> <p>“The whole club is hot for the new season, we want to be even better,” he said.</p> <p>“We want to chase the opponents and the ball over the entire field, continue to be a super unpleasant team that is not fun to play.
